architecture
Crate layout, trait surfaces, and data-flow for grex v1.
Workspace
Single crate grex (lib + bin). Sub-crates avoided in v1 to keep the plugin trait crate vendored in the same compilation unit. v2 may split grex-plugin-api into its own crate for ABI stability.

Verb → module map
| CLI verb | Entry module | Primary collaborators |
|---|---|---|
init | cli::init | manifest::io, gitignore, concurrency |
add | cli::add | manifest, pack::discovery, plugin::packtype, fetchers::git, gitignore |
rm | cli::rm | manifest (tombstone), plugin::packtype::teardown, gitignore |
ls | cli::ls | manifest::fold, manifest::lock |
status | cli::status | manifest, per-pack-type status dispatch |
sync | cli::sync | fetchers::git, concurrency::scheduler, recursion |
update | cli::update | sync + pack-type.install if lockfile delta |
doctor | cli::doctor | manifest integrity, gitignore diff, schema validate |
serve | cli::serve | mcp::* |
import | cli::import | legacy REPOS.json ingest → manifest::event::Add |
run | cli::run | plugin::action, cli::output |
exec | cli::exec | tokio::process, concurrency::scheduler |

pack::walk traverses two distinct edges in the pack graph:
childrenedge — ownership. The walker clones missing children, recurses into them, and applies their lifecycle transitively.depends_onedge — verification only. The walker checks each named/URL'd prerequisite resolves to a present, satisfied pack in the workspace; it does NOT clone or recurse. Unresolveddepends_onentries are a hard error at plan phase, before the scheduler dispatches any action. See pack-spec.md §childrenvsdepends_on.
Runtime invariants
- I1 (Lean4 v1 proof): scheduler never holds two concurrent locks on the same pack path.
- I2: every manifest append is preceded by acquiring the global fd-lock.
- I3:
.gitignoremanaged-block sync is idempotent — running it twice is a no-op on disk. - I4: compaction output is fold-equivalent to its input.
- I5: pack tree walk terminates (cycle detection).
See concurrency.md for I1's Lean4 formalization.
